Which of the following types of protein modification involves the attachment of a ubiquitin molecule to a lysine residue on the target protein?
Explanation
Ubiquitination is a type of post-translational modification that involves the attachment of a ubiquitin molecule to a lysine residue on the target protein, marking it for degradation or altering its activity.
